随着互联网的快速发展,网络流量高峰已成为困扰各大互联网企业的难题。在高峰时段,用户访问量激增,服务器压力剧增,导致网络拥堵、页面加载缓慢,严重影响用户体验。如何应对互联网流量高峰,已成为网络流量分发技术领域亟待解决的问题。本文将从以下几个方面探讨网络流量分发技术在应对互联网流量高峰中的应用。

一、分布式架构

分布式架构是应对互联网流量高峰的关键技术之一。通过将系统部署在多个服务器上,实现负载均衡,可以有效分散流量压力,提高系统并发处理能力。以下是分布式架构在应对流量高峰方面的具体应用:

  1. 负载均衡:通过负载均衡技术,将用户请求分配到不同的服务器上,实现流量的均匀分配,避免单点过载。

  2. 数据库分片:将数据库拆分为多个分片,分散存储数据,提高数据库并发处理能力。

  3. 缓存:利用缓存技术,将频繁访问的数据存储在内存中,减少对数据库的访问,降低系统压力。

二、内容分发网络(CDN)

内容分发网络(CDN)是一种通过在全球范围内部署节点,实现快速内容分发和缓存的技术。在应对互联网流量高峰方面,CDN具有以下优势:

  1. 快速响应:CDN节点分布广泛,用户请求可以直接访问最近的服务器,降低响应时间。

  2. 缓存:CDN可以将热点内容缓存到节点上,减少对源站的访问,降低源站压力。

  3. 负载均衡:CDN可以实现跨地域、跨运营商的负载均衡,提高整体网络性能。

三、智能路由技术

智能路由技术可以根据网络状况、用户需求等因素,动态调整数据传输路径,实现流量优化。以下是智能路由技术在应对流量高峰方面的应用:

  1. 路由优化:根据网络状况,智能选择最优路径,降低网络延迟。

  2. 资源调度:根据用户需求,动态调整资源分配,提高系统并发处理能力。

  3. 容灾备份:在主节点出现故障时,智能路由技术可以自动切换到备用节点,保证系统稳定运行。

四、边缘计算

边缘计算将计算能力从云端下沉到网络边缘,实现实时数据处理和响应。在应对互联网流量高峰方面,边缘计算具有以下优势:

  1. 低延迟:边缘计算可以将数据处理和响应延迟降低到毫秒级别,提高用户体验。

  2. 资源利用率:边缘计算可以充分利用网络边缘的计算资源,提高整体网络性能。

  3. 灵活性:边缘计算可以根据实际需求,动态调整计算能力,适应不同场景。

五、总结

面对互联网流量高峰,网络流量分发技术需要不断创新,以应对日益增长的用户需求。通过采用分布式架构、CDN、智能路由技术、边缘计算等技术,可以有效应对互联网流量高峰,提高网络性能和用户体验。未来,随着技术的不断发展,网络流量分发技术将更加成熟,为我国互联网产业提供有力支撑。